Output cefdf0fb1c922266eb765d0c34d63032cb1aaf64924b201e842b0a4b65f2a291:2

value
17894505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a510b89df89907e32b2bd380b0f21f1c629e835 OP_EQUAL
address
MHbJwsgK6ciAiCA5ohbsBrDZ1VQHej5bj3
transaction
cefdf0fb1c922266eb765d0c34d63032cb1aaf64924b201e842b0a4b65f2a291
spent
true